Right now we have a number of things that are disabled or broken arising from the Into the Void patch and before. To list a few:
-
It’s 15 days since we had trophy trading disabled;
-
It’s 11 days since harvesting animals was disabled due to the drop rate of materials;
-
It’s 10 days since the undocumented changes from the patch were acknowledged and we were told fixes would be worked on.
Obviously there has been a patch to restore missing items and implement some fixes arising from Into the Void but all of the above remain in the game with zero communication about timeframes.
I fully understand that issues in play are complex and need time to investigate, design & implement a change and test but there has to be a way for you to provide some communication on these subjects beyond saying there is “no update”.
Given the nature of software development and sprints to implement work there is at least some high level information that could be used to help communicate. I understand you do not wish to be tied to a specific date but any timeframe provided would be better than the existing void of information on these (and other) topics.
Is the plan for one big update to fix multiple things that will take time? Or is the plan to implement small fixes to address specific issues in priority? What is the priority for what is broken or disabled? Will fixes that will be deployed go straight to production or is there plans for them to have xx days on PTR for testing first? Will anything be fixed before your studio heads off for the festive break?
I really want the game to succeed and I want things to improve. Saying that, I am finding it harder to play each day with the problems that are presently outstanding and would appreciate any information beyond “no update yet” please.
Could you please provide a constructive statement on the key issues that would help manage community expectations and timeframes?
